Kathryn L. Wall, 90, of Batavia since 1998, formerly of Glen Ellyn since 1960, died April 14 at the Johnson Healthcare Center in Carol Stream. She was born Jan. 25, 1913, in Barrington.

Mrs. Wall was a music teacher and devoted her entire career within the Glen Ellyn public grade schools for more than 40 years. She was raised and educated in Barrington and received her master’s in music education from the University of Illinois, Champaign. She was a member of the First United Methodist Church of Glen Ellyn, where she was a member of the 60-60 Club and was choir director of the club. She was a member of the Retired Rhythm Rascals Dixie Land Band, playing the piano.

Mrs. Wall is survived by her daughter, Linda (Clifford) Nelson of Bolton, Conn.; four grandchildren, Dawn Ussery, Dayleen Bushnell, Christopher Nelson and Eric Nelson; a brother, Ned Coe of Chicago; four great-grandchildren; and many nieces and nephews. She was preceded in death by her husband, George G.

Funeral services were held April 19 at the Leonard Memorial Home, Ltd., Glen Ellyn, with the Rev. Bonnie L. Beckonchrist officiating. Interment was in White Memorial Cemetery of Cuba Township in the Barrington area. Memorials may be made to the American Cancer Society, 999 N. Main St., Glen Ellyn, IL 60137.
